Franklin County magistrates press for details on $30,000 public-relations proposal

Franklin County Fiscal Court · November 20, 2025
AI-Generated Content: All content on this page was generated by AI to highlight key points from the meeting. For complete details and context, we recommend watching the full video. so we can fix them.

Summary

Magistrates discussed a proposed paid public-relations and marketing package — including podcasts, radio spots and social-media management — that presenters called a short-term 'bridge' to an eventual in-house communications director; several magistrates requested more data on reach, RFP process, liability and timing before advancing the proposal.

Frankfort — Franklin County Fiscal Court members heard a presentation on Nov. 19 for a paid public-relations and marketing proposal that would produce podcasts, social-media content and 60-second radio spots and cost up to $30,000 over the coming period.

The presenters — identified in the record as Kristen Cantrell and the proposal team — said the program would act as a temporary "bridge" to create a blueprint for an eventual in-house public-information director and that the county would own produced materials.
